Hello,
I am using Excel to schedule construction processes for homes. It is set up by columns. Example "Column B..Row 2" gets the actual date typed in and I set up calculations to add days to the schedule. For instance: Column B..Row 3 would be Row 2 +1. I want to have Saturday and Sunday automatically add 2 days to the calculation. I would need the new dates to carry forward. Is this possible? |
